http://www.urban75.org/london/astoria-london-music-venue.html The London Astoria was a music venue at 157 Charing Cross Road, in London, England. Originally a warehouse during the 1920s, the building became a cinema and ballroom. It was converted for use as a theatre in the 1970s. After further development, the building re-opened in the mid-1980s, as a … See more The Astoria was built on the site of a former Crosse & Blackwell warehouse and opened in 1927 as a cinema.
